Is Salesforce admin free to use?

You can make use of the Salesforce admin account to create free web apps and to get a real-time experience of working in the Salesforce environment. Admin orgs are 100% free forever and will remain active as long as you log in once every six months.

What does an entry level Salesforce Admin do?

The responsibilities of an entry-level Salesforce administrator include monitoring access levels to the dashboard (or visual representation of data compiled from a report or reports), creating new user profiles, running deduplication tools, and training people how to utilize the applications.

What is Salesforce admin?

Salesforce Admin – An individual that helps a company get the most out of Salesforce, extending functionality using “clicks not code”. Admins focus on ensuring the system is working for its users, building functionality based on new requirements, fixing bugs, and training users.


What is Salesforce Business Analyst?

Salesforce Business Analyst – An individual that will look at a companies’ processes, and figure out what is working, and what is not working, in order to create user requirements for the Salesforce implementation.

How many certifications does Salesforce have?

Salesforce has over 35 certifications that span a number of different products, disciplines, as well as experience levels. Getting a Salesforce certification will be a requirement for most jobs, and at a foundational level, the best cert to aim for is the Salesforce Certified Administrator.

Volunteering for Non-Profits

Volunteer projects are a fantastic way to expand your network, build a resume, sharpen your skills, prepare stories for interviews, and help a great cause. They can also lead to paid opportunities down the line, which has happened to me and many of my colleagues.


Completing Real World Projects

Completing sample projects is something a lot of people talk about, but very few actually do. This is a great way to showcase your skills, and prove your value to get experience without a job.


Superbadges

Superbadges on Trailhead, combine the standard quizzes and hands-on practical challenges, with a use case and complex business problem. You will need to understand the business problem, and then implement a solution for it.
